I am currently a HS LMS relocating to another area of
the country.  I have an interview at an elem school
and part of the interview will be conducting a lesson
for 1st grade.  I have 2 ideas and was hoping that you
could read them and perhaps send me your opinions-
ways to improve/ it's dumb/ too hard/ to easy, etc.  I
am trying to keep it simple since I have never seen
these children before.

1.  Select a Caldecott (perhaps Officer Buckle and
Gloria).  Discuss (briefly) what a Caldecott Medal is,
what it is awarded for, etc.  I would then read the
book.  After reading the book, I was thinking of
asking them a couple of questions.  Then I would give
them paper and crayons and have them illustrate a
character or scene from the book.

2.  Fiction/ non-fiction
_Ask if they know the difference between the two.
Talk about it a little.
Take a fiction book about spring and read it to the
class.  Take a nf book and read a couple of passages.
Then discuss the differences as they relate to the
books.
